Podcast Studio Build

The studio build for The Cheat Code — a two-camera, two-host podcast/video setup. Every line item below is priced three ways — buy-new on Amazon, used online (eBay / MPB / Reverb), and local pickup on Facebook Marketplace (Downtown LA). Click any price to go straight to the listing.

Prepared June 17, 2026 Location Downtown Los Angeles Target budget ~$6,800 Show The Cheat Code Setup 2× Sony FX30 · ATEM live switch · SM7B audio

ATEM Mini Pro ISO

Blackmagic ATEM Mini Pro ISO

×1

8-input HDMI live switcher · records isolated feeds of every camera + program. The hub of the whole rig.

Your budget: $600

Pick: low-risk used item — local or eBay around $400–450 saves ~$150 vs new.

Sony FX30 body

Sony FX30 (body)

×2 · ~$1,600 ea

Super 35 cinema camera. Prices shown per body; totals below are for the pair.

Your budget: $3,200 (pair)

Pick: on a $3k+ camera, buy used from MPB (~$1,570 ea, 6-mo warranty, graded). FB is cheapest if you can inspect in person.

Tamron 17-70mm f/2.8

Tamron 17-70mm f/2.8 (Sony E)

×2 · ~$500 ea

Di III-A VC RXD — the do-everything APS-C zoom for the FX30s. Per-lens prices; totals are for the pair.

Your budget: $1,000 (pair)

Pick: used ~$500–520 ea lands the pair right at budget. New is +$560.

Shure SM7B

Shure SM7B

×2 · ~$439 ea

Broadcast dynamic mic — the podcast standard. Per-mic prices; totals are for the pair. (Part of the Audio line.)

Part of $400 audio budget · underfunded

Pick: mics age gracefully — used ~$300–330 ea is a safe buy and saves ~$220+.

RODE PodMic USB

RØDE PodMic USB Mic · Option B

×2 · ~$180 ea

Budget alternative to the SM7B — dynamic broadcast mic with both USB-C and XLR, built-in pop filter + APHEX DSP. Runs on the Rødecaster (XLR) or straight into a computer (USB).

2 mics ≈ $360 new — fits the original $400 audio budget

Pick: at $180 ea, buy new — a pair is ~$360 (vs ~$660–878 for two SM7Bs), keeping audio inside the original $400 line. The SM7B stays the recommended mix pick for top-tier sound; PodMic USB is the value play.

Rodecaster Pro

Rødecaster Pro (original)

×1

Podcast mixer/interface for both SM7Bs. Original is discontinued — new = Pro II; the original lives on the used market. (Part of the Audio line.)

Part of $400 audio budget · underfunded

Pick: used original ~$340–380 on Reverb/FB. Only go Pro II ($699 new) if you want the newer features.

COB LED light

3-point lighting kit

key + fill + back

Suggested build: 3× COB LED (e.g. Amaran 100d S / 150c) + softboxes + light stands. Prices are for the full kit.

Your budget: $1,000

Pick: COB lights are common on local resale — a used Amaran/Godox kit ~$600–700 comes in well under budget.

LG 32UN550-W 32 inch 4K monitor

LG 32UN550-W (32" 4K UHD)

×1 · 31.5"

32" 4K UHD (3840×2160) display, HDR10, height-adjustable stand. Doubles as the ATEM's live preview over HDMI and your editing screen.

Your budget: $300

Pick: buy new (~$299 at Amazon/Walmart) for full warranty + dead-pixel coverage — it's right at budget. Used 32" 4K runs ~$180–210 if you'd rather save ~$100.

Ongoing subscription — episode review & edits

Frame.io
Frame-accurate comments & approvals on every cut
Recurring

Frame.io — review & collaboration

subscription

Upload each episode so your partner and editor can leave timestamped comments, approvals, and edit notes in one place — instead of scattered texts and screenshots. Now an Adobe product.

Billed monthly · not part of the ~$6,800 one-time gear budget

Pick: Pro at $15/member·mo (~$13 billed annually, ~13% off) — for 2 hosts ≈ $30/mo / ~$360/yr. Trial it free first; move to Team only if you add reviewers or need 3 TB+.
